Leveraging Geospatial Data to Understand Social Mixing in Cities
Understanding the impact of dense social interactions in urban areas is crucial for designing inclusive cities, as they contribute to both the benefits and challenges of urban living. Various urban planning paradigms and design approaches, such as the 15 minute city, aim to foster social connection...
